7. Maintenance

IMPORTANT: Always disconnect the power supply before performing any maintenance.

  1. Regular Cleaning of Filter Sponges: The filter sponges should be cleaned regularly, typically every 2-4 weeks depending on pond conditions.
    • Unclip the safety buckles and open the unit cover.
    • Remove the filter sponges and rinse them thoroughly with pond water (not tap water, to preserve beneficial bacteria).
    • Clean the filter material box if necessary.
    • Reassemble the unit, ensuring the cover is securely clipped.

  2. UV-C Lamp Replacement: The 13W UV-C lamp has an effective lifespan of approximately 8000 hours. When the lamp's effectiveness diminishes (indicated by reduced water clarity despite clean filters), it should be replaced.
    • Disconnect power.
    • Open the unit and carefully remove the UV-C lamp housing.
    • Replace the old lamp with a new 13W UV-C lamp. Handle new lamps by their ends to avoid touching the glass.
    • Reassemble and ensure all seals are correctly seated before submerging.

8.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Pump not operating.No power supply; Impeller blocked; Damaged motor.Check power connection and outlet; Disconnect power, clean impeller; Contact support if motor is damaged.
Reduced water flow or fountain height.Clogged filter sponges; Blocked fountain head/nozzle; Low water level; Flow adjuster setting.Clean filter sponges; Clean fountain head/nozzle; Ensure adequate water level in pond; Adjust flow control.
Pond water remains cloudy/green.Clogged filter media; UV-C lamp ineffective/burnt out; Pond size exceeds capacity; Excessive nutrients.Clean/replace filter media; Check UV lamp observation window, replace lamp if necessary; Ensure unit is suitable for pond volume; Reduce feeding, perform partial water changes.
UV-C lamp observation window shows no light.UV-C lamp burnt out; No power to unit.Replace UV-C lamp; Check power connection.
